During the conversation, the minister provided detailed information about the progress made in the country's energy sector over the past two to three years, as well as current and future projects in this area.

Talaybek Ibraev also suggested that the consortium representatives consider the possibility of constructing thermal power plants (TPPs) at coal deposits in Kyrgyzstan.

The consortium, in turn, expressed its readiness to develop, finance, and build three thermal power plants, each with a capacity of 350 MW, totaling 1050 MW. The project will be implemented using clean coal technologies in accordance with international standards, and the consortium has relevant experience in constructing such facilities.

The representatives of the consortium noted that the application of modern technologies will ensure reliable, environmentally friendly, and stable electricity production based on coal. To this end, studies of coal deposits are planned, which will include assessments of ash content, moisture, volatile substances, sulfur and phosphorus content, as well as the calorific value of the coal.

The minister emphasized the importance of conducting the necessary research by the consortium's specialists for the successful implementation of the project and expressed the Ministry of Energy's readiness to provide full support within its authority.
